Output 1421692616dd9a1c00888717abfb10e878bf94dda8176cabbddcedae53b1e725:1

value
18920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522627c5ebcd61f67c990fcc4bce0d43327d50ff OP_EQUAL
address
9yvdnCcNcpnGfV5Wy7SyuaeuNTGEYXEGRK
transaction
1421692616dd9a1c00888717abfb10e878bf94dda8176cabbddcedae53b1e725